From traditional competitions to water crises, compelling images capture the world's events.
A Maasai warrior showcases athleticism in a high-jump contest at the Maasai Olympics in Kajiado, Kenya, as reported by Luis Tato/AFP. Meanwhile, in Johannesburg, South Africa, residents of Coronationville experience dire water shortages, waiting in queues for relief. The crisis continues to grip the city as water supplies dwindle, according to Roberta Ciuccio/AFP.
In Ukraine, Anna and her mother are seen awaiting evacuation from Donetsk as Russian forces press onward, an image captured by Roman Pilipey/AFP. Cyclone Chido's devastation has left the French Indian Ocean territory of Mayotte grappling with a humanitarian crisis, as reported by Gonzalo Fuentes/Reuters. With a reported 31 dead and many missing, concerns grow over a potentially higher casualty count.
Anatoly Maltsev/EPA-EFE captures the illuminated monument to Admiral Ivan Kruzenshtern against a cold St Petersburg backdrop, where temperatures plummet to -10C (14F). In Folkestone, Kent, Gareth Fuller/PA Media highlights the transformation of the White Horse on Cheriton Hill into a festive Rudolph ahead of Christmas celebrations.
Elsewhere, Paris boasts its vast indoor ice rink at the Grand Palais des Glaces where skaters glide gracefully, as shown by Stephane De Sakutin/AFP. Dutch violinist Andre Rieu dazzle audiences in Maastricht with a concert featuring his orchestra, soloists, dancers, and skaters, exemplified by Leonhard Foeger/Reuters.
Kyle Negomir from the United States is hard at work on the downhill course in Val Gardena, Italy, preparing for the Alpine Ski World Cup, while Danny Lawson/PA Media documents the training. Lastly, Alida Freding wears a candle crown symbolizing St Lucy during the Sankta Lucia Festival of Light, an event captured in photography at York Minster.
